Internet of twins: Supporting different simulations of different types of things that communicate together, such as vehicles that communicate on the road, requires the connection of digital twins and appropriate protocols, which transforms the Internet of Things (IoT) into the Internet of Twins. These twin networks will be the key to reducing operational complexity, easily exploring and testing alternatives, and improving real-time and virtual reality.

There are no leaders: In the world of tokenized organizations around the world with destructive tokens called DAOs (autonomous organizations), the distribution of power is one group and ‘jointness’: cooperation without submitting to a central leadership, focusing only on making profits and achieving joint goals . DAOs lead to unique governance, light but strong, with a group of dedicated supporters, guided by common principles.

At Capgemini
Capgemini is a global leader in partnering with companies to transform and improve their business through the power of technology. The group is guided every day by its mission to unleash the power of people through technology for an inclusive and sustainable future. It is a trusted and diverse organization of more than 350,000 members in more than 50 countries. With 55 years of strong experience and industry expertise, Capgemini is trusted by its clients to meet all their business needs, from concept and design to operations, fueled by a growing world agile and innovative in cloud, data, AI, communications, software, digital engineering and platforms. The group reported in 2021 a global revenue of €18 billion.
